Features
2.5 A maximum peak output current 2.0 A minimum peak output current 500 ns maximum propagation delay 350 ns maximum propagation delay difference 40 kV/μms minimum Common Mode Rejection (CMR) at VCM = 2000 V ICC = 5.0 mA maximum supply current Under Voltage Lock-Out protection (UVLO) with hysteresis Wide operating VCC Range: 15 V to 30 V Industrial temperature range: -40°C to 105°C Safety Approval — UL Recognized 7500 VRMS for 1 min — CSA — IEC/EN/DIN EN 60747-5-5 VIORM = 2262 VPEAK
Applications
High Power System – 690VAC Drives IGBT/MOSFET gate drive AC and Brushless DC motor drives Renewable energy inverters Industrial inverters Switching power supplies CAUTION It is advised that normal static precautions be taken in handling and assembly of this component to prevent damage and/or degradation that may be induced by ESD. - 13 - ACNT-H313 Data Sheet Applications Information Applications Information Selecting the Gate Resistor (Rg) to Minimize IGBT Switching Losses Step 1: Calculate Rg minimum from the IOL peak specification. The IGBT and Rg in Figure 24 can be analyzed as a simple RC circuit with a voltage supplied by the ACNT-H313. The VOL value of 2 V in the previous equation is a conservative value of VOL at the peak current of 2.5 A (see Figure 6). At lower Rg values, the voltage supplied by the ACNT-H313 is not an ideal voltage step. This results in lower peak currents (more margin) than predicted by this analysis. When negative gate drive is not used VEE in the previous equation is equal to 0 V. Figure 24 ACNT-H313 Typical Application Circuit Step 2: Check the ACNT-H313 Power Dissipation and Increase Rg if necessary. - 14 - ACNT-H313 Data Sheet Applications Information For the circuit in Figure 24 with IF (worst case) = 12 mA, Rg = 8 , Max Duty Cycle = 80%, Qg = 500 nC, f = 20 kHz and TA max = 85°C. The value of 4.25 mA for ICC in the previous equation was obtained by derating the ICC max of 5 mA (which occurs at –40°C) to ICC max at 85°C (see Figure 7). Since PO for this case is smaller than PO(MAX), Rg of 8 can be used. - 15 - ACNT-H313 Data Sheet Thermal Model Thermal Model Definitions: Ambient Temperature: Junction-to-Ambient Thermal Resistances were measured approximately 1.25 cm above optocoupler at ~23°C in still air. Related Documents This thermal model assumes the device is soldered onto a high conductivity board as per JEDEC 51-7. The temperature at the LED and Detector junctions of the optocoupler can be calculated using the following equations: T Using the given thermal resistances and thermal model formula in this datasheet, we can calculate the junction temperature for both LED and the output detector. Both junction temperatures should be within the absolute maximum rating of 125°C.
